General Dynamics (NYSE:GD) secured a U.S. Navy contract modification worth up to $2.31b for Virginia-class Block VI submarines, extending support through 2035. The company’s GDIT unit entered a new technology partnership with NightDragon to advance U.S. government cybersecurity, AI and autonomy solutions. In the first quarter of 2026, General Dynamics reported revenue of US$13.5 billion and diluted EPS of US$4.10, with particularly strong growth in its Marine Systems and Aerospace segments and companywide bookings of US$26.6 billion. The company’s backlog rose to about US$131 billion and management raised full-year EPS guidance to US$16.45–US$16.55, underscoring how recent contract wins and improved shipyard productivity are feeding into longer-term earnings visibility.
